Summary:Fort McHenry National Monument, Baltimore, Maryland. Caption reads: “George Armistead was the commander of the fort in September 1814. Under his leadership it withstood a 25 hour British bombardment. A statue, the work of Edward Berge, was erected in his honor 100 years later.” Circa 1961-1971. Postcard number: DT-72754-C.
